v7 = same arch as v4/v5/v6 (dim768/18L, bf16, 8-GPU DDP global 256),
trained the SAME 2.255B-token FineWeb-edu subset to 1.45 epoch (vs v6's
1.02), best FineWeb val 3.0149 (v6 3.0652). Exported + archived to
registry v7-fineweb-edu-dim768, serves in xserv (coherent expository
English, ~v6 quality).
Key finding: more epochs of the SAME subset gave only ~0.05 val drop and
the curve flattened (~step 44000) with no sampling quality gain → the
2.255B FineWeb subset is near its ceiling at dim768. Same class as v5's
TinyStories data-volume saturation: repeating old data has thin margins;
true further gains need FRESH shards (more diverse tokens), as v6's
corpus-swap (which raised the ceiling) showed.

Scaling run v2 design doc + comparison-table update. v2 = dim384/12L/12h
SwiGLU ffn1536 (core 28.32M, total 66.92M), trained 4500 steps / ~36.9M
tokens on full TinyStories (reused v1 u16 cache) via NCCL DDP across 4
RTX 5090s. Best val 1.7055 (train 10.89→1.72), a clear jump over v1 2.58
and v0 3.80. Exported to xserv (135 BF16 tensors) and archived in the
dash5 registry; xserv greedy token-matches xtrain on 2/3 fixed prompts
(3rd diverges late under BF16 drift). Records the DDP weak-scaling caveat
(global batch too small → all-reduce dominates) → links docs/known-issues
KI-1; v3 proposal applies KI-1's fix (much larger global batch).
